#3fa389 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#3fa389 is composed of 24.7% red, 63.9%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 16%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 164.4 degrees, a saturation of 44.2% and a lightness of 44.3%. #3fa389 color hex could be obtained by blending #7effff with #004713.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#3fa389 color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#3fa389 has RGB values of R:63, G:163,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 4170633.
